Sin City is a 2005 crime thriller that brings Frank Miller's graphic novels to the screen with stylized black-and-white visuals and interlocking stories of corruption, revenge, and redemption. Set in a dark, morally ambiguous metropolis, the film follows crooked cops, vigilantes, and desperate characters navigating a city that rewards brutality over justice. When was Sin City released?

Sin City was released on April 1, 2005.

What is Sin City about?

The film is a collection of interconnected crime stories set in a corrupt city, featuring tough antiheroes — crooked cops, vigilantes, and desperate characters — caught between vengeance, redemption, and survival in a morally broken world.

Is Sin City based on anything?

Yes, Sin City is adapted from Frank Miller's graphic novel series of the same name, faithfully translating the source material's distinctive black-and-white visual style and noir storytelling to film.
